Notice the underlined words in these sentences and choose the option that best explains their meanings.

“When a people are enslaved, as long as they hold fast to their language it is as if they had the key to their prison.”

It is as if they have the key to the prison as long as they ______

पर्याय

  • do not lose their language.

  • are attached to their language.

  • quickly learn the conqueror’s language.

उत्तर

It is as if they have the key to the prison as long as they are attached to their language.
